Abstract
The purpose of this article is to analyze the hidden polemic conveyed by memes about the emergency remote teaching, experienced during the COVID-19 pandemic in Brazil. To this end, we analyzed three memes that circulated on social networks during the years 2020 and 2021, through the theoretical-methodological contribution of Dialogical Discourse Analysis, especially the notion of hidden polemic. The results indicate that the authors of the memes use the hidden polemic as a way of confronting aspects of the so-called capitalist, traditional pedagogical and technological discourses. Meanings and effects of meanings are produced by these dialogical relationships, which go towards a broader social critique. This criticism reveals both the weaknesses of emergency remote teaching and the social inequalities that hindered its viability.
